Lucknow flights from London take 13-17 hours depending on your routing. The city is served by Chaudhary Charan Singh International Airport (LKO), located 14km from city centre (Amausi). There are no direct flights from the UK; all routes connect through Dubai, Abu Dhabi, Sharjah, Muscat.
The main airlines serving this route include Emirates, Etihad Airways, Qatar Airways, Gulf Air. Most connections route through Middle East or Asian hubs, with layover times of 2-5 hours. Dubai or Abu Dhabi (around 13 hours) offers one of the quickest journey times.
Return fares range from £450-550 in low season to £700-920 during peak periods. October-March sees the highest demand. Book 6-8 weeks ahead for the best deals.
